Well after upping Cpu voltage to 1.4 setting NB to 1.250 and SB to 1.5 [both stock!] fsb is at 400
Running at 3.6 gigs which is not bad at all Ram freq is 800
After that if I up fsb system locks [memory freq goes up....]
Tried at 411 [3.7] but system will not boot
Not sure if I should up Cpu voltage .... or what I really think I should do is call it day
Amazing cpu for the money ....
